Since it arrived late last year, the Sound + Doctrine podcast from Sovereign Grace Music has time-and-again distilled Biblical, practical wisdom from a lifetime of faithful music ministry into brief, engaging conversations.

The goal has been to equip and encourage those who lead sung worship in the local church; and I’d say, it does it brilliantly. Listening along with others from my church and further afield has led to some great discussions, caused me to think more deeply about a breadth of issues surrounding music ministry, and provided a great way to train others when it’s been hard to meet them in person.
